December 27, 2007

ambiance plus food excellence equals a memorable dining experience. Visiting from DC over Xmas and celebrating our wedding anniversary, I was intrigued by the picture of the room and the Bouley name. Other reviews had expressed disappointment in both the food and the service. Our experience was overwhelmingly positive. The room is gorgeous and the first impression is that of a more formal restaurant. The host is a bit officious, but loosens up. Similarly, the meal slows its pace by the entree, and the dessert course is Bouley at his best. The palate cleansers are remarkable. Because I had noted on my reservation that this was a wedding anniversary, we got two desserts -- we couldn't decide between them -- and gratis glasses of Muscat plus a platter of sweets. Then a handwritten card arrived with best wishes and a thank you (probably the warmest dining experience I've had in NYC). My wife had duckling, I had fish, and we both liked the idea that in addition to the tasting menu, one could choose either from the American or the Austrian menu. We sampled from each. The beet salad is a thing to behold -- even before you taste it! On the way out through the now-teeming bar, the hostess handed my wife a breakfast bread in a plastic bag -- another gift from Bouley. If you want to relax and dine in pastel surroundings with service that is attentive but not hectoring, go to Danube.

September 14, 2007

Wonderfully romantic ambiance, food slightly disappointing. Tucked away in a fairly grimy part of lower Manahattan, when you enter Danube you are transported into a world of elegance. Save this one for a special occasion, when you are not rushed to be somewhere else, and where you want you and whomever you are with to feel special. It's perfect for a romantic meal, or even to impress an out-of-town client.

The food is mostly excellent, but not extraordinary. The goulash, supposedly a house special, was a disappointment. Other courses ranged from very good to superb (the creme brulee with figs and balsamic ice cream). Service was competent, but our waiter asked us three times, "is everything delightful?" That's simply not appropriate for a restaurant of this level.
